概述:
TPP(Third Party Provider)钱包文件,通常指第三方支付或开放银行场景下用于描述、校验与授权钱包实体的配置与凭证文件。该文件既可用于后台服务间的安全通信(证书、密钥、签名策略),也可用于钱包客户端的能力声明(支持的资产、接口、回调地址、版本信息等)。
文件结构与常见字段:
- 元信息(meta):钱包ID、发行方、版本、生成与过期时间、环境标识(prod/testnet)。

- 权限声明(scopes/permissions):允许的操作(支付、查询、退款、结算)与额度限制。
- 接入端点(endpoints):API地址、回调(webhook)地址、PAX/终端通信协议说明。
- 密钥与证书(keys/certs):公钥、证书链、加密方式(RSA/ECC)、签名算法(RSASSA-PSS、ECDSA)。私钥不应直接在文件中明文保存,可引用密钥ID或HSM路径。
- 认证与授权(auth):OAuth2配置、mTLS要求、JWT签名字段规范。
- 合规与KYC:合规标识、支持的KYC等级与限制。
- 日志与审计(audit):事件上报策略、监控标签。
格式与示例:
常见采用JSON或CBOR格式以便轻量传输,文件通常被签名(Detached/Embedded)并可加密封装(CMS/PKCS#7)。生产环境应区分测试网(testnet)与主网(mainnet)配置,避免混淆。
安全与管理要点:
- 私钥隔离:使用HSM或云KMS管理私钥,避免将私钥嵌入文件。
- 证书策略:采用短期证书+自动轮换机制,防止长期凭证滥用。
- 最小权限:权限声明精细化、按需授权并做速率限制。
- 完整性校验:文件签名与哈希校验,变更需记录并可回溯。
便捷数字支付视角:
TPP钱包文件是实现“即插即用”支付体验的关键桥梁:通过标准化权限与端点声明,钱包与收单、发卡、清算系统可以快速互鉴,支持二维码、NFC、PAX终端直连与线上一键支付场景,从而提升用户体验与支付成功率。
PAX与终端集成:
PAX(既指PAX Technology支付终端厂商,也可泛指PAXOS等支付资产)在TPP生态里的角色分两类:
1) PAX终端:需要在钱包文件中声明POS协议、设备ID、固件版本与通信密钥;测试网应提供终端模拟器与验证脚本。
2) PAXOS/稳定币:若钱包支持数字资产(如USDP/PAX),需在文件中声明链上地址、托管与合规参数、兑换与结算规则。
测试网(Testnet)实践:
- 隔离环境:提供与主网相同的API但独立账本,避免真实资金风险。
- 自动化用例:覆盖注册、签名验证、异常恢复、设备离线等场景。
- 数据回放与模拟:支持模拟网关断连、延迟与并发峰值测试,验证钱包文件在极端情况下的鲁棒性。
市场未来趋势预测:
- 标准化与互操作性:行业将倾向于统一TPP钱包文件规范,推动跨平台互通。
- 数字资产融合:钱包将混合托管法币与数字货币(包括央行数字货币CBDC),文件需支持多资产声明。
- 隐私与合规并进:采用可验证凭证(VC)、零知识证明减少数据泄露同时满足KYC。
- 智能合约与自动结算:对于跨境与B2B场景,钱包文件将包含智能合约地址与自动化结算规则。
- 终端+云协同:如PAX终端与云端钱包文件联动,形成线上线下无缝支付链路。
实施建议与落地路线:
1) 定义最小可行文件规范(MVP):明确必需字段与可选扩展。
2) 搭建测试网与终端仿真器(含PAX仿真),进行端到端验证。
3) 引入自动化密钥轮换与审计链,采用HSM/KMS与CI/CD联动。
4) 分阶段推广:先在受控环境试点,再逐步扩展至生产、跨域互通。
结论:

TPP钱包文件不仅是技术配置文档,更是连接钱包、终端(如PAX)、清算与监管的重要契约。通过标准化、安全化与测试网验证,可实现便捷的数字支付体验,并为未来多资产、智能结算与跨境互操作打下基础。
评论
Alicia
对测试网部分的建议很实用,尤其是PAX终端模拟器的想法很值得借鉴。
张凯
关于密钥管理能否补充一些HSM选型与运维细节?很有帮助。
Node99
文章把PAX的双重含义讲得很清楚,便于工程和合规团队沟通。
李思思
市场趋势预测部分很前瞻,特别是可验证凭证与零知识证明的结合方向。